In this video, I break down my top 5 HDMI cables for 2025 that actually make sense for smooth gaming and clean streaming—especially if you’re running a PS5, Xbox Series X, a modern 4K/120 TV, or you’re building a home theater setup. The big goal here is simple: pick a cable that can handle the bandwidth you need (up to 48Gbps for HDMI 2.1), so you’re not dealing with random black screens, flicker, or features not working the way they should. I cover what to look for with 8K@60Hz and 4K@120Hz support, plus gaming and audio features like VRR, ALLM, Dynamic HDR, and eARC. I also call out practical stuff people forget—like braided durability, shielding to cut interference, and choosing the right length (especially if you’re going 10–15 feet to a TV, projector, or receiver).
